On the 7 October 2019, Britannia will set sail for her first refit at the Damen shipyard in Brest, France.


Britannia will be back in Southampton on 23 October 2019, ready for the next four years of adventures in the Caribbean, Norwegian Fjords, Mediterranean, Canary Islands and more.

Britannia’s Refit and latest photos

For her next chapter, P&O Cruises are maximising your favourite areas on Britannia. The atrium will be given a new lease of life to create a lively social hub at the heart of the ship. There will be a new colour scheme and a fresh design direction, relaxed entertainment and a lively scene with music and informal performances under the starburst chandelier.

Deck 7 on Britannia

The Java café on deck 7 will now serve alcoholic drinks. 

The photo gallery will also be getting some TLC, including the welcome addition of a Dixons electronics hub featuring the latest imaging, computing and audio tech from Amazon, Apple, Beats, Bose, Canon, Fitbit, GoPro, Microsoft and Sony, among others.

Deck 5 on Britannia

P&O Cruises are introducing a permanent new art gallery next to Blue Bar on deck 5 by the atrium.

The Market Café also on deck 5 has already benefited from new furniture and décor, and a brand-new menu including decadent ice-cream creations, made in exclusive collaboration with Hampshire dairy Jude’s.

Shopping on Britannia

Britannia will feature a host of new premium brands and a more interactive environment, including try-before-you-buy tasting tables and consultation areas in our beauty and make-up zones. Jo Malone, Tom Ford, Edinburgh Gin, Michael Kors accessories and exclusive fine jewellers, Clifton, will be joining the line-up.

Oasis Spa and Salon

Two ‘express spa’ pods will boast a range of treatments. In one pod, you’ll enjoy high-tech massages; in the other, a zero-gravity lounger will offer express skin treatments as well as LVL lash treatments. There will be two innovative new experiences in the thermal and hydropool suite. Brace yourself for the therapeutic benefits of the Arctic cold room and let everyday stresses ease away in the aroma steam room.
